Linking the Pacific and Atlantic Oceans, the Northwest Passage is only navigable by ships for a few weeks a year after the peak of summer. Many 19th century European explorers tried to traverse the passage as a possible trade route to Asia, often with journeys ending in disaster. Today, the Northwest Passage is accessible by ice-strengthened expedition ships – but the icy waters still retain their mystic charm.

Other highlights of the cruises include crossing the Arctic Circle, cruising along the icebergs at Ilulissat Icefjord in Greenland, visiting the historic remnants of the Franklin Expedition, seeing polar bears, walrus, muskox, seabirds, seals and whales in their natural habitats, and visiting Devon Island which, at over 50,000 square kilometres, is the largest uninhabited island on earth, and home to many geological and natural features.
